Projektowanie stron internetowych jak zacząć?

Aby rozpocząć przygodę z projektowaniem stron internetowych, warto zainwestować czas w naukę kilku kluczowych umiejętności. Przede wszystkim, znajomość języków programowania takich jak HTML, CSS oraz JavaScript jest niezbędna. HTML stanowi podstawowy język do tworzenia struktury strony, natomiast CSS pozwala na stylizację i nadanie estetycznego wyglądu. JavaScript natomiast umożliwia dodawanie interaktywności oraz dynamicznych elementów na stronie. Kolejnym ważnym aspektem jest zrozumienie zasad UX/UI, które dotyczą doświadczeń użytkownika oraz interfejsu użytkownika. Dobrze zaprojektowana strona powinna być intuicyjna i łatwa w nawigacji. Warto również zaznajomić się z narzędziami do prototypowania oraz edytorami graficznymi, takimi jak Adobe XD czy Figma, które ułatwiają tworzenie wizualnych koncepcji stron. Dodatkowo, umiejętność pracy z systemami zarządzania treścią, takimi jak WordPress, może być bardzo pomocna w tworzeniu i zarządzaniu stronami internetowymi. Nie można zapominać o znajomości podstaw SEO, które pozwolą na lepsze pozycjonowanie strony w wyszukiwarkach internetowych.
Jakie narzędzia są najlepsze do projektowania stron internetowych?
Wybór odpowiednich narzędzi do projektowania stron internetowych ma ogromne znaczenie dla efektywności pracy oraz jakości końcowego produktu. Na początek warto zwrócić uwagę na edytory kodu, takie jak Visual Studio Code czy Sublime Text, które oferują wiele funkcji ułatwiających pisanie kodu. Dzięki nim można szybko i sprawnie tworzyć oraz edytować pliki HTML i CSS. Do stylizacji strony przydatne będą również frameworki CSS, takie jak Bootstrap czy Tailwind CSS, które pozwalają na szybkie budowanie responsywnych layoutów. W przypadku grafiki warto skorzystać z programów takich jak Adobe Photoshop lub GIMP do tworzenia i edytowania obrazów. Prototypowanie to kolejny istotny krok w procesie projektowania, dlatego warto poznać narzędzia takie jak Figma lub Sketch, które umożliwiają tworzenie interaktywnych prototypów stron. Systemy zarządzania treścią, takie jak WordPress czy Joomla!, są również niezwykle pomocne w łatwym tworzeniu oraz zarządzaniu treściami na stronie bez konieczności posiadania zaawansowanej wiedzy technicznej. Ostatnim elementem jest korzystanie z narzędzi analitycznych, takich jak Google Analytics, które pozwalają na monitorowanie ruchu na stronie oraz analizowanie zachowań użytkowników.
Jakie są najważniejsze kroki w procesie projektowania stron internetowych?

Proces projektowania stron internetowych składa się z kilku kluczowych etapów, które należy starannie przeanalizować i wdrożyć. Pierwszym krokiem jest zbieranie wymagań od klienta lub określenie celów projektu, co pozwoli na stworzenie jasnej wizji tego, co ma być osiągnięte. Następnie warto przeprowadzić badania rynku oraz analizę konkurencji, aby zrozumieć trendy oraz oczekiwania użytkowników. Kolejnym etapem jest stworzenie architektury informacji oraz mapy strony, co pomoże w zaplanowaniu struktury witryny i ułatwi późniejsze etapy projektowania. Po ustaleniu struktury można przystąpić do tworzenia wireframe’ów oraz prototypów wizualnych, które pomogą zobrazować układ elementów na stronie. Kiedy prototypy zostaną zaakceptowane przez klienta lub interesariuszy, można przystąpić do właściwego kodowania strony przy użyciu wybranych technologii i narzędzi. Po zakończeniu prac programistycznych następuje testowanie witryny pod kątem błędów oraz jej optymalizacja pod względem wydajności i SEO.
Jakie są najczęstsze błędy podczas projektowania stron internetowych?
Podczas projektowania stron internetowych istnieje wiele pułapek, w które mogą wpaść nawet doświadczeni twórcy. Jednym z najczęstszych błędów jest brak odpowiedniej analizy potrzeb użytkowników przed rozpoczęciem prac nad projektem. Ignorowanie oczekiwań odbiorców prowadzi często do stworzenia witryny, która nie spełnia ich wymagań ani nie jest intuicyjna w obsłudze. Kolejnym problemem może być nieodpowiedni dobór kolorystyki oraz czcionek, co wpływa negatywnie na estetykę i czytelność strony. Zbyt duża ilość informacji na jednej stronie może przytłoczyć użytkowników i sprawić, że będą mieli trudności ze znalezieniem interesujących ich treści. Ważne jest także zapewnienie responsywności witryny – brak dostosowania do różnych urządzeń mobilnych może skutkować utratą potencjalnych klientów. Inny błąd to niedostateczne testowanie przed uruchomieniem strony; niewykryte błędy mogą prowadzić do frustracji użytkowników i obniżenia reputacji marki. Ostatecznie zaniedbanie aspektów SEO może skutkować niską widocznością strony w wynikach wyszukiwania, co ogranicza jej potencjał dotarcia do szerszej grupy odbiorców.
Jakie są najlepsze praktyki w projektowaniu stron internetowych?
W projektowaniu stron internetowych istnieje wiele sprawdzonych praktyk, które mogą znacząco poprawić jakość i efektywność tworzonych witryn. Przede wszystkim, warto skupić się na prostocie i przejrzystości interfejsu. Użytkownicy preferują strony, które są łatwe w nawigacji i nie przytłaczają ich nadmiarem informacji. Dlatego kluczowe jest, aby układ elementów był logiczny i intuicyjny. Kolejną ważną praktyką jest zapewnienie responsywności strony, co oznacza, że powinna ona dobrze wyglądać i działać na różnych urządzeniach, od komputerów stacjonarnych po smartfony. Warto również zwrócić uwagę na szybkość ładowania strony; użytkownicy często rezygnują z odwiedzin, jeśli strona ładuje się zbyt długo. Optymalizacja obrazów oraz minimalizacja kodu HTML, CSS i JavaScript mogą pomóc w osiągnięciu lepszej wydajności. Dobrze jest także stosować zasady dostępności, aby upewnić się, że strona jest użyteczna dla osób z różnymi niepełnosprawnościami. Używanie odpowiednich nagłówków, opisów alternatywnych dla obrazów oraz kontrastujących kolorów to tylko niektóre z zasad, które warto wdrożyć.
Jakie źródła wiedzy są najlepsze dla początkujących projektantów stron internetowych?
Dla osób rozpoczynających swoją przygodę z projektowaniem stron internetowych istnieje wiele wartościowych źródeł wiedzy, które mogą pomóc w nauce i rozwijaniu umiejętności. Na początek warto zwrócić uwagę na kursy online oferowane przez platformy edukacyjne takie jak Udemy, Coursera czy edX. Oferują one szeroki wachlarz kursów dotyczących HTML, CSS, JavaScript oraz innych technologii związanych z tworzeniem stron internetowych. Kolejnym cennym źródłem są blogi oraz kanały YouTube prowadzone przez doświadczonych projektantów i programistów. Dzięki nim można zdobyć praktyczne wskazówki oraz poznać najnowsze trendy w branży. Warto również korzystać z dokumentacji technicznej dostępnej na stronach takich jak MDN Web Docs czy W3Schools, gdzie można znaleźć szczegółowe informacje na temat poszczególnych języków programowania oraz narzędzi. Fora dyskusyjne i grupy społecznościowe na platformach takich jak Reddit czy Stack Overflow to kolejne miejsca, gdzie można zadawać pytania i dzielić się doświadczeniami z innymi projektantami. Nie można zapominać o książkach dotyczących web designu oraz UX/UI, które dostarczają solidnych podstaw teoretycznych i praktycznych w tej dziedzinie.
Jakie są różnice między projektowaniem a programowaniem stron internetowych?
W kontekście tworzenia stron internetowych często pojawia się pytanie o różnice między projektowaniem a programowaniem. Projektowanie stron internetowych koncentruje się głównie na estetyce oraz doświadczeniu użytkownika. Obejmuje to tworzenie layoutu, dobór kolorystyki, typografii oraz ogólną stylistykę witryny. Projektanci muszą mieć umiejętność myślenia wizualnego oraz rozumienia zasad UX/UI, aby stworzyć intuicyjne i atrakcyjne interfejsy dla użytkowników. Z drugiej strony programowanie stron internetowych dotyczy aspektów technicznych związanych z budowaniem funkcjonalności witryny. Programiści piszą kod w językach takich jak HTML, CSS oraz JavaScript, a także mogą korzystać z frameworków i bibliotek do tworzenia bardziej zaawansowanych aplikacji webowych. Programowanie wymaga umiejętności logicznego myślenia oraz znajomości algorytmów i struktur danych. W praktyce obie te dziedziny często współpracują ze sobą; projektanci muszą komunikować swoje pomysły programistom, a programiści muszą rozumieć ograniczenia wynikające z projektu graficznego.
Jakie są najważniejsze trendy w projektowaniu stron internetowych?
Trendy w projektowaniu stron internetowych zmieniają się dynamicznie wraz z rozwojem technologii oraz zmieniającymi się potrzebami użytkowników. Jednym z najważniejszych trendów ostatnich lat jest minimalizm – prostota i czystość formy stają się coraz bardziej popularne wśród projektantów. Użytkownicy doceniają przejrzyste układy oraz ograniczoną ilość elementów wizualnych, co ułatwia im koncentrację na treści strony. Kolejnym istotnym trendem jest responsywność; coraz więcej osób korzysta z urządzeń mobilnych do przeglądania internetu, dlatego strony muszą być dostosowane do różnych rozmiarów ekranów. Interaktywność to kolejny ważny aspekt nowoczesnych witryn – animacje oraz efekty parallax przyciągają uwagę użytkowników i sprawiają, że korzystanie ze strony staje się bardziej angażujące. Również personalizacja treści staje się coraz bardziej powszechna; dzięki analizom danych użytkowników możliwe jest dostosowywanie zawartości strony do ich indywidualnych preferencji. Warto również zwrócić uwagę na rosnącą popularność dark mode – ciemne motywy kolorystyczne są nie tylko estetyczne, ale także przyjazne dla oczu podczas długiego przeglądania treści online.
Jakie wyzwania stoją przed projektantami stron internetowych?
Projektanci stron internetowych stają przed wieloma wyzwaniami w swojej pracy, które mogą wpłynąć na jakość tworzonych witryn oraz satysfakcję klientów. Jednym z głównych wyzwań jest szybkie tempo zmian technologicznych; nowe narzędzia i technologie pojawiają się niemal codziennie, co wymaga od projektantów ciągłego uczenia się i dostosowywania do nowych warunków rynkowych. Kolejnym problemem może być różnorodność urządzeń i przeglądarek internetowych; zapewnienie spójnego wyglądu i działania strony na wszystkich platformach to zadanie wymagające dużej precyzji oraz testowania. Współpraca z klientami również może stanowić wyzwanie; często zdarza się, że oczekiwania klientów są niejasne lub zmieniają się w trakcie realizacji projektu, co może prowadzić do frustracji obu stron. Dodatkowo konieczność przestrzegania zasad SEO staje się coraz bardziej skomplikowana; algorytmy wyszukiwarek regularnie ulegają zmianom, co wymaga od projektantów znajomości aktualnych wytycznych dotyczących optymalizacji treści pod kątem wyszukiwarek internetowych.